How Much Will Elon Musk Neuralink Cost

As reported by the Wall Street Journal, Elon Musk’s Neuralink invention is causing quite the stir. It is said to be a ‘mind-reading’ device that can connect human brains to computers. It will be a tiny implantable robot that Musk has promised will one day enable us ‘to control technology with our thoughts’. There is plenty of hype around the capabilities of musk’s invention, but how much will it cost?.

The cost of Neuralink is not public knowledge however there are currently some estimates that suggest it’s likely to be very expensive. According to some financial analysts, the cost of a Neuralink implant could range anywhere from an estimated $20,000 to £200,000. It is also likely that once this technology is released, the cost of the implantable device could either go down or become more expensive, depending on the success of the invention.

When talking about the cost of the device, experts suggest that the demand could be high as Musk’s Neuralink could provide people with the means to have a far stronger connection with technology and machines. According to some experts, this could revolutionise the way we use technology, as it could rid of the need to physically control smartphones, computers and other smart devices.

The way the device works is through the surgical implantation of a tiny robot into the user’s body. This robot will be connected to the user’s brain, giving them the capability to control technology with their thoughts. The device is said to be very small — just 4mm by 8mm in size — and sits directly on top of the user’s brain.

The technology used to create the device is called a ‘brain-machine interface’. This type of technology is said to have a wide range of applications, from providing neuroprostheses to helping people manage their mental health.

It is also said that this new technology could be beneficial for those with physical disabilities, improving the quality of their lives and reducing their reliance on healthcare professionals and caregivers.

Dr. Julio Martinez-Trujillo, a neuroscientist from McGill University, believes that this device could benefit those who are suffering from neurodegenerative diseases, such as Alzheimer’s or Parkinson’s Disease. He suggests that this technology could be used to monitor a patient’s brain activity and thereby alert medical professionals if the patient starts to decline.

Social Impact

As with many inventions that have strong implications, the social impact of Neuralink can be both positive and negative. One of the more prevalent positives is the potential this device has to help those with physical and mental disabilities in ways that no other devices are currently capable of.

For instance, it could help those with mobility issues to interact with their environment more independently. As well, it could increase mental health awareness and reduce the stigma that still surrounds mental health conditions.

The potential negative effects of Neuralink are yet to be seen, however many have raised concerns about the implications this device could have on human privacy. Historically, governments around the world have put restrictions on the technology and products that can be used to read a person’s mental or physical state.

Experts suggest that if this technology is not properly regulated, it could be used as a form of surveillance and or even a means of controlling individuals. This is a real concern amongst those who are wary of the potential implications this technology could have for the world.

Security Measures

Given the potential implications of Neuralink, it is critical that security measures are taken to ensure the safety of those using the device. According to some experts, this device could potentially be hacked and or accessed by those with malicious intent.

Therefore, it is important that the technology is developed with security measures in place that will protect user privacy and data. This is likely to involve encryption and other measures to ensure the device cannot be accessed by anyone other than the owner.

Much like the cost of Neuralink, the exact security measures that will be put in place are not yet known. However, it is likely that these will be addressed in the wake of the device’s release.
